Who is involved in the governance of the Project?
The Social and Health Education Project is governed by a Management Committee comprising people from a range of backgrounds who have undertaken training with the Project, as well as individuals who are professionally involved in the fields of personal and community education or development. In 2004 new structures were introduced in order to enhance democratic participation in the governance of the Project. These structures include three policy-shaping fora, respectively for Project Trainers, Community Tutors and Coiscéim Counsellors. An Association of Friends was also established. Both the policy-shaping fora and the Association of Friends have formal representation on the Project’s Management Committee. The Management Committee is supported in its task of policy formulation by two advisory groups: the Training and Development Services Advisory Group and the Therapeutic Support Services Advisory Group. Those sitting on the advisory groups are experienced people whose guidance is sought by the Management Committee in relation to specific policy questions. The Management Committee is supported in the delivery of Cork Advocacy Service by an Expert Consultative Group that includes people with specialist expertise from outside the Project.
